Credit by Examination We accept a maximum of 16 credits, combined, for coursework completed by an examination, such as the College Level Examination Program (CLEP), or professional training approved by the American Council on Education (ACE). For credits transferred from an American college or university, the College will consider only courses completed at a degree-granting institution of higher education that has been fully accredited by one of the six regional accrediting agencies (e.g., the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ools), or from a program approved prior to study by the Committee on Educational Policy and Curriculum. Even if the DE courses show up on a high school transcript a college will not acknowledge those credits unless an official transcript is sent directly from the college the course was taken at to the matriculating college the student is currently enrolled.
